Abstract

A movable device and a block-type millimeter wave array antenna module thereof are provided. The block-type millimeter wave array antenna module includes an antenna carrying substrate, an antenna signal transmitting group, an antenna signal receiving group, and a dummy antenna group. The antenna carrying substrate includes a plurality of block-shaped carrier bodies that are divided into a plurality of first, second, third, and fourth antenna carrier blocks. The antenna signal transmitting group includes a plurality of signal transmitting antenna structures respectively carried by the first antenna carrier blocks. The antenna signal receiving group includes a plurality of signal receiving antenna structures respectively carried by the second antenna carrier blocks. The dummy antenna group includes a plurality of first dummy antenna structures respectively carried by the third antenna carrier blocks, and a plurality of second dummy antenna structures respectively carried by the fourth antenna carrier blocks.
